Southwest: Booking curve for holidays trending in line with 2019 levels.

22 October, 2021

Southwest Airlines reported (21-Oct-2021) lingering effects from the deceleration in bookings in 3Q2021 are estimated to negatively impact 4Q2021 operating revenues by approximately USD100 million. For Oct-2021, despite the improvement in revenue and booking trends experienced in the second half of Sept-2021, operating revenues include an estimated USD40 million negative impact due to the delta variant and an estimated USD75 million negative impact as a result of flight cancellations from operational challenges. Despite this and based on current bookings, the company's guidance for Oct-2021 operating revenues remains unchanged, as the recent improvement in travel demand trends offsets the aforementioned headwinds. Business revenues continue to lag leisure revenue trends however Southwest is encouraged by recent improvement in business travel demand resulting in steady improvements in business bookings. Beyond Oct-2021, the current booking curve for the holidays is trending in line with 2019 levels. [more - original PR]
